Origin and history

Notre-Dame-de-l'Assomption de Salles-sur-Mer is a religious monument located in the commune of Salles-sur-Mer. Although its existence is attested, the available sources do not specify its construction period or details of its architectural or cultural history. This type of monument, typical of French communes, often plays a central role in local life, both spiritually and communally.

In New Aquitaine, a region marked by a rich historical diversity, parish churches such as that of Salles-sur-Mer were traditionally gathering places for the inhabitants. They served not only as a framework for religious offices, but also as spaces for social events and collective decisions. Their presence reflects the importance of the Christian faith in the organization of villages and small towns throughout the centuries.
